Who’s Responsible for an Uber or Lyft Crash in McLean County?

Rideshare accidents often involve multiple layers of insurance and complex liability determinations. In McLean County, whether the driver was “on app,” en route to pick up a passenger, or transporting someone at the time of the crash affects how your case is handled.

Our McLean County rideshare crash lawyer investigates:

  • Whether the driver was logged into Uber or Lyft at the time
  • Whether corporate coverage applies (up to $1M) or only personal insurance
  • Whether third-party drivers were also at fault
  • Location-specific details from Bloomington Police or Normal PD

Act Fast — Illinois Has a Deadline for Filing Rideshare Injury Cases

Don’t lose your rights by waiting too long. Illinois law gives rideshare accident victims just 2 years to file a lawsuit. That window can shrink in certain scenarios, especially when Uber/Lyft app data is deleted or if insurance disputes arise early.

FAQs — Uber & Lyft Injury Claims in McLean County

Who’s liable if I’m injured in a rideshare in McLean County?

Uber or Lyft drivers, the parent company, or another vehicle operator may share responsibility. Our team investigates the full crash context to determine liability.

What can I claim after a crash near Constitution Trail or Hershey Road?

You may claim for hospital bills, missed wages, emotional distress, and future rehab. Property damage and pain, and suffering are also considered.

How do I file a Lyft accident claim in McLean County?

First, retain your ride receipt, file a police report, and consult with an experienced attorney who can begin negotiations or formal litigation.

Is there a deadline to sue after a rideshare crash in McLean County?

Yes — two years from the date of injury, in most cases. However, swift action is key to preserving evidence and maximizing your claim value.

What if Uber or Lyft insurance denies my claim?

Our firm appeals denials with full documentation. If necessary, we escalate the case in court and fight for fair compensation based on your injuries.
